Porsche Planning a Panamera Junior, Still Considering Ferrari FF–Baiting Coupe

Porsche Planning a Panamera Junior, Still Considering Ferrari FF–Baiting Coupe:

The Porsche Panamera (above) will have a smaller sibling.
Porsche is planning to add a mid-size four-door to its lineup. Internally referred to as Pajun, as in Panamera Junior, the low-slung hatchback sedan will be based on Audi’s MLB platform—just like the upcoming Macan crossover SUV. Priced between $60,000 and $100,000, the new four-door will compete with the likes of the Mercedes-Benz CLS, the Audi A7, the Jaguar XF, and an upcoming baby Quattroporte from Maserati.
